Rochester Lourdes trailed by three points at halftime, but fought back to beat Stewartville 79-63 in Hiawatha Valley League girls basketball Tuesday night at Lourdes.
"I am very proud of the girls tonight," Lourdes coach Aaron Berg said. "There was a lot of adversity thrown our way and the kids were able to battle through it. We really need to clean up our play on both ends (however) if we are going to compete down the road."
Lourdes won the game thanks to its 3-point shooting. It hit seventh threes, compared to just one by Stewartville.
Anna Branstad led the Eagles with 21 points. Katie Helt added 17 points, Madison Berg 11 and Megan Hobday 10.
Lourdes moved to 2-1 in the HVL and 3-1 overall.

Kara O'Byrne had 22 points for Stewartville, which is 0-2, 0-3.
